mysql数据库默认的引擎和表指定的引擎有什么区别?
如果你的数据库表有指定存储引擎,那么数据库的默认引擎配置是不生效的,当且仅当你在建表语句中没有指定所使用的引擎,此时这个表的存储引擎就会是数据库中配置的默认引擎
mysql默认值是多少?
mysql默认值有以下几个类型:
1 指定列的默认值
columnName int default '-1'
2 integer 列-设置自增列 也是指定默认值的方式
3 默认值必须是常量 不能使用函数、表达式---特例:timestamp datetime 列可以指定current_timestamp做为默认值
4 blob text geometry json 数据类型不能指定默认值
5 如果没有明确指定默认值,mysql会有一个默认的默认值:numeric 类型 默认0;第一个timestamp 列默认current date and time
字符串类型:默认是空字符串,enum类型默认是枚举的第一个值
6 查看表的默认值:show create table tablename
alter table [tablename] drop constraint [标识] ALTER TABLE [tableName] ADD CONSTRAINT [标识] DEFAULT (25) FOR [columnName] 如果原字段没有默认值,下面一句就不用写了: alter table [tablename] drop constraint [标识] 即先给此字段添加一个默认值 要已经有了默认值就写上面的Ok
查看mysql修改默认格式?
安装MySql时其默认编码格式是拉丁编码格式的,这样在存储汉字的时候就会出现“?”的错误: 查看编码格式的命令:show variables like 'character%'; 修该其编码格式: 打开mysql安装目录,里面有个my.ini文件,打开这个文件,里面有两处字符集的设置,默认是拉丁,建议你所想改的,如:utf8或gbk 然后启动mysql服务,以后创建的数据库默认字符集就是ok了。
idea自带了mysql吗
ideaui是一个强大的代码编辑器,也支持扩展插件的开发或引入,因此ideaui工具也提供了插件链接仓库界面,里头可以下载很多自己喜欢的扩展插件的,目的是为了能够帮助开发人员提高编码效率。
idea-ui不会内置任何数据库,但插应用件市场里头有很多链接数据库插件,用户可以下载相应的扩展插件来方便直接在ideaui上进行配置链接数据库,并可以编写sql语句完成对数据库的相关操作。
如果链接mysql,则直接搜索mysql connector即刻,然后选择对应自己数据库的版本即可。
不是1、因为 “IDEA” 是一个 集成开发工具(Integrated Development Environment), 针对Java语言开发,无法完成直接处理MySQL数据库数据的操作。
通过它链接MySQL数据库来源于支持的第三方库和插件,但是不是自带的。
2、因此,如果我们想要通过IDEA链接MySQL数据库,需要自己下载并且配置相关的库和插件,这样才能完成与MySQL数据库的数据操作。
还没有评论,来说两句吧...